Diana Walters, director at Trilogy Metals, sells $703,000 in shares

Director Diana J. Walters of Trilogy Metals Inc. (NYSE:TMQ) recently sold 100,000 common shares of the company at a price of $7.03, for a total value of $703,000. The sales occurred on October 8, 2025. The price range for these sales was between C$9.56 to C$10.07. The transaction comes as TMQ shares have surged over 411% year-to-date, with the stock currently trading near its 52-week high of $7.98. On the same day, Walters also exercised options to acquire 100,000 common shares at an exercise price of $1.81, totaling $181,000. Following these transactions, Walters directly owns 51,302 shares of Trilogy Metals, representing a stake in the company’s $988 million market capitalization. In other recent news, Trilogy Metals has been at the center of multiple developments. The company saw a significant boost when President Trump signed an executive order to construct an access road to the Ambler Mining District in Alaska. This move is expected to facilitate crucial infrastructure development for Trilogy’s operations in the region. Following this, BMO Capital downgraded Trilogy Metals from Outperform to Market Perform, although it raised the price target to $5.50 from $3.00. The downgrade came after a significant re-rating of Trilogy shares due to the U.S. federal government’s investment in the company’s Ambler Road Project. Conversely, Cantor Fitzgerald upgraded Trilogy Metals from Speculative Buy to Buy, increasing its price target to $10.00 from $3.00. This upgrade was based on a re-evaluation of future financings and expectations of less future equity dilution. These recent developments highlight the evolving landscape for Trilogy Metals as it navigates new federal support and analyst assessments.
